Recycled and renewable content

To reduce our dependence on finite resources it is important to use recycled materials and renewable materials within new products. There are label solutions available that contain up to 100% recycled content. For renewable label solutions there are a range of label material options made from natural, organic sources rather than finite resources. Examples of these bio-based label materials include cane fibre paper, PE made entirely from sugar cane ethanol and MarbleBase made from 80% marble mining waste and 20% recycled HDPE.

Enables reuse, recycling or composability

Reusing, recycling or composting packaging helps reduce waste and circulate resources back into the economy. Wash-off label material options helps enable both re-use of containers such as glass and plastic bottles as well as the recyclability of plastic packaging as the label cleanly separates from what it was attached to leaving no residue behind and not disrupting the recycling process. A label solution we offer is CleanFlake label technology which helps enable both PET and HDPE packaging recycling.

Compostable labels attached to compostable packaging can positively contribute to an increased collection of organic waste as food waste can be commingled with its packaging and labels. Sourced responsibly

Products that are responsibly sourced come from a supply chain that shows care for people and the environment. Label solutions that demonstrate they are responsibly sourced includes paper labels that are made with wood fibre certified by the Forest Stewardship Council (FSC). This certification is reassurance that the paper has been sourced from sustainable and well managed forests.
